CSDN论坛 > VC/MFC > 基础类

为什么我的程序能通过编译但不能运行,Rebuild all后才能正常运行? [问题点数:40分,结帖人edoch]

Bbs2
本版专家分:143
结帖率 100%
CSDN今日推荐
Bbs1
本版专家分:81
Bbs1
本版专家分:81
Bbs2
本版专家分:284
Bbs4
本版专家分:1210
Bbs3
本版专家分:692
Bbs2
本版专家分:349
Bbs6
本版专家分:9178
Bbs6
本版专家分:5100
Bbs2
本版专家分:472
Bbs3
本版专家分:861
Bbs4
本版专家分:1600
Bbs6
本版专家分:6434
Bbs4
本版专家分:1463
Bbs4
本版专家分:1463
匿名用户不能发表回复!
其他相关推荐
Maven -- 使用插件打包时,提示java编译异常,但是本地服务可以正常运行
Maven 错误找不到符号问题,通常有三种原因: 这里写图片描述 1. 可能项目编码格式不统一。 2. 可能项目编码使用的JDK版本不统一。 3. pom依赖问题,这种依赖可能是没有添加包的依赖,如果是聚合项目可能是没有添加其他模块的依赖,或者是添加了其它模块的依赖,但是没有将依赖的模块打包到本地仓库等。上面几点,是我在网上找到的,摘自:http://blog.csdn.net/u01206
能够编译,为啥就是不能运行通过???
先上代码(PS :特简单的一段): import java.io.*; class A { public static void main(String args[]) throws Exception { ObjectInputStream input = new ObjectInputStream(new FileInputStream("MyClass.java")); My
Maven项目出现红叉,但是编译和运行都没错
查看到的错误信息如下: Description Resource Path Location Type Project configuration is not up-to-date 解决的方式是:选中项目右键->Maven4MyEclipse(用的是MyEclipse开发工具)-->update project configuration...->选则要更新的项目(即出现红叉的项目)
你是不是也经常遇到Xcode编译成功,但又无法运行的情况?
使用模拟器或真机测试时,出现如下提示: 这里可以将 Executable file string 里的内容改为 ${PRODUCT_NAME} 然后重启Xcode(完全退出XCode,不是关闭当前项目再打开),模拟器,真机可以正常运行,问题解决! 其他可供参考解决方法: A.修改info.plist 里Bundle identifier里面${
VS2008能编译却不能运行的情况,不能“调试”的解决方法
vs2008,打开后编译,不能调试,报错: The Visual Studio Debugger ({C9DD4A57-47FB-11D2-83E7-00C04F9902C1}) did not load because of previous errors. For assistance, contact the package vendor.
Debug 运行正常,Release版本不能正常运行的相关详解
引言      如果在您的开发过程中遇到了常见的错误,或许您的Release版本不能正常运行而Debug版本运行无误,那么我推荐您阅读本文:因为并非如您想象的那样,Release版本可以保证您的应用程序可以象Debug版本一样运行。 如果您在开发阶段完成之后或者在开发进行一段时间之内从来没有进行过Release版本测试,然而当您测试的时候却发现问题,那么请看我们的调试规则1: 规则1: 经常性
JLINK断开程序不能运行问题
通过JLINK把程序烧到了FLASH里,但拔出JLINK连电脑的USB端(另一端还连在板子的JTAG口),程序就不运行了,这是为什么?      我曾以为程序不是烧到了FLASH里而是在RAM中,但是明显在MDK设置的时候是选择了烧到FLASH里的。而且这个开发板,把BOOT1给接地了,所以根本没办法将程序烧到SRAM里。      STM32F10X手册里的说明:          
关于使用JCreator编译后无法运行的解决方法
报错现象:java文件能够正常编译,但是不能在工具中运行 --------------------Configuration: -------------------- Usage: java [-options] class [args...]            (to execute a class)    or  java [-options] -jar jarf
STM32 编译后不能运行的几个原因
一、编译和链接都可以通过,但uVision MDK不能全速运行,一运行就停止了,原因在于Option->Target->Code Generation->Use MicroLIB 复选框没有打钩,一般来说,针对一运行就停止的情况,将Use MicroLIB勾选之后,重新编译,运行就可以通过了。 编译后不能运行的几个原因" title="STM32 编译后不能运行的几个原因" style="m
IAR编译的工程无法正常仿真的问题
解决IAR编译的工程无法仿真的问题
关闭